A short New Years walk around Shoreham (Kent) village on a grey, murky new year's day.

There are four pubs (one , only opens at weekends as a testaurant) and we had a drink in The Crown, a very old beamed traditional pub.

The other pub in my blip is the Olde George Inn which originates from 1500.

The Mount Vineyard, our local winery, was closed today. We miss our Sunday rural walks to the vineyard, and hope that in the not too distant future I will be able to cope with this 9 mile circular ramble.

Shoreham is a lovely conservation village in the Darent Valley with many historical buildings .The River Darent runs through it and the adjacent footpath was very muddy today.
